Description

Pyrimidine, 4-Phenoxy- (9Ci) is a specialized heterocyclic aromatic compound that serves as a valuable chemical building block. Its unique structure, featuring a phenoxy substituent on the pyrimidine core, makes it a critical intermediate in advanced synthetic chemistry. This compound is primarily sought by research and development teams in the pharmaceutical and agrochemical industries for the synthesis of novel active ingredients and functional materials.

Application

  • Pharmaceutical Intermediate: Key precursor in the synthesis of novel drug candidates, particularly for antiviral, anticancer, and central nervous system (CNS) active compounds.
  • Agrochemical Synthesis: Used in the research and development of new herbicides, fungicides, and plant growth regulators.
  • Material Science Research: Serves as a building block for creating advanced organic materials, including liquid crystals and organic semiconductors.
  • Chemical Biology Probes: Utilized in the development of molecular probes and inhibitors for studying enzyme function and biological pathways.
  • Academic & Industrial R&D: Fundamental research compound in organic chemistry for exploring new reaction methodologies and heterocyclic chemistry.

Basic Information

Product Name Pyrimidine, 4-Phenoxy- (9Ci)
CAS No. 78430-23-6
Molecular Formula C10H8N2O
Molecular Weight 172.18 g/mol
Synonyms 4-Phenoxypyrimidine; Phenoxypyrimidine; 4-Phenoxy-pyrimidine; 4-Phenoxy-1,3-diazine; Pyrimidine, 4-phenoxy-; 4-(Phenoxy)pyrimidine; 1,3-Diazine, 4-phenoxy-
